Disneyland Paris is the biggest amusement park and the most visited tourist destination in Europe. With more than 15 million visits per year, you can imagine that you won’t be alone in one of its 57 attractions. With 61€ for one park and 74€ por both parks, you want to make your ticket profitable. But as you’ll have to queue to enter the park, then you can be waiting for more than one hour at each attraction, you’ll be happy if you have done 6 attractions at the end of the day.

So, what’s the secret to enjoy Disneyland Paris without queuing?
- First avoid weekends and holidays
- Organise your visit the day after a long weekend. All parents rush with their children to “Mickey’s world“ during long weekends. Then if you take a day off just after a long weekend you can be sure that all parents are back to their routine taking their kids to school!
- Choose a day with bad weather (really, trust me: once it was almost snowing and there was nobody in the park and second time it was raining cats and dogs and we didn’t have to queue more than 10 min)
- Use the fastpass card. You can ask it at the park’s entrance, it’s free. It gives you access to the priority queue during some time of the day you choose. The only time it was announced a queue of 25 min we used this card and just waited for 5 minutes.
- Go to the most popular attractions during lunch (from 1pm to 2pm is the best time).

And now some bonus for the thrill-seekers! If you want to prepare your itinerary among thrills’ attractions, there is a dedicated page on Disneyland website. Our favorites were Rock ‘n’ Roller Coaster starring Aerosmith, The Twillight Zone Tower of Terror and of course Space Mountain: Mission 2.
